Understanding SQL Server

SQL Server, developed by Microsoft, is a relational database management system designed to store, manage, and retrieve data efficiently. It uses structured query language (SQL) for communicating with databases and is renowned for its robustness, scalability, and security.

Key Components of SQL Server

  1. Database Engine: At its core, SQL Server is driven by the Database Engine, responsible for data storage, retrieval, and management. It includes the query optimizer, which enhances query performance, and transaction management for data consistency.

  2. SQL Server Management Studio (SSMS): SSMS is a graphical user interface (GUI) tool used for configuring, managing, and interacting with SQL Server databases. It simplifies tasks such as creating tables, writing queries, and administering security.

  3. Integration Services (SSIS): SSIS is a data integration and workflow automation tool within SQL Server. It enables developers to create data extraction, transformation, and loading (ETL) processes.

  4. Analysis Services (SSAS): SSAS facilitates data analysis and reporting by providing multidimensional data models. It supports business intelligence solutions, enabling users to gain insights from their data.

  5. Reporting Services (SSRS): SSRS is a reporting tool that allows users to create, deploy, and manage reports. It offers various visualization options for presenting data.

  6. Azure SQL Database: Azure SQL Database is a cloud-based version of SQL Server, offering the benefits of scalability, high availability, and disaster recovery in a cloud environment.

Benefits of SQL Server

  1. Scalability: SQL Server can scale vertically and horizontally, making it suitable for both small businesses and large enterprises. It can handle high volumes of data and traffic without compromising performance.

  2. Security: SQL Server provides robust security features, including encryption, authentication, and role-based access control. It ensures data remains protected from unauthorized access and breaches.

  3. Performance: SQL Server is optimized for performance, with features like indexing, query optimization, and in-memory processing. It delivers fast query response times, critical for real-time analytics.

  4. Business Intelligence: With SSAS and SSRS, SQL Server empowers organizations to build comprehensive business intelligence solutions, facilitating data-driven decision-making.

  5. High Availability: SQL Server offers high availability options, including failover clustering, database mirroring, and Always On Availability Groups. These ensure minimal downtime and data redundancy.

Real-World Applications

SQL Server is not just a database system; it’s a robust ecosystem that has found applications in various domains:

  1. Enterprise Resource Planning (ERP) Systems: SQL Server serves as the database backend for ERP systems, enabling businesses to manage and streamline operations efficiently.

  2. E-commerce Platforms: Online retailers rely on SQL Server to store product information, customer data, and transaction records securely.

  3. Healthcare Information Systems: Healthcare organizations use SQL Server to manage patient records, billing information, and medical data.

  4. Financial Services: Banks and financial institutions leverage SQL Server for transaction processing, fraud detection, and regulatory compliance.

  5. Manufacturing: SQL Server helps manufacturers track production, inventory, and supply chain data for optimized operations.
